Ex Vitro Method to Promote Jatropha Plant an Advantage to Mankind and Boon To Farmers
In the recent times, advancements in the field of agriculture in the kind of ex-vitro plant propagation have proved useful to the male kind. One such plant, which has actually been established by ex-intro, is Jatropha, discovered in large quantities in Indonesia. This plant contains 25 to 35 percent oil and can be utilized to produce biodiesel, saving land, and an increase in the earnings of farmers.
Earlier, there were specific difficulties while growing the Jatropha plant. Firstly, the proliferation and transportation of the seedlings of Jatropha was pricey and lengthy. The soil in which, it grows is low in productivity triggering the plant to decay and have illness and last but not the least, the Jatropha plant takes considerable time to adjust itself, to the new environment.
Observing all these hurdles, the farming experts advocated ex-vitro Jatropha proliferation. The ex-vitro of jatropha curcas fixed the challenges, dealt with earlier of planting it. The seedling treatment was made quickly and affordable. The expense of transportation was decreased, as the seedlings were planted nearby, in the location of the plantation. Mother plants were selected from the exact same area, which did not need the seedlings to adapt themselves, therefore saving time.
The ex-vitro Jatropha technique embraced in the plant proliferation plan had root culturing as its basis, where the shoots were grown outside the field in the glass vessels. The platelets grown from this, was automatically seasoned in the green home. The seedlings were highly heterogeneous, in character and thus, high level of propagation was possible.
The ex-vitro jatropha curcas method showed to be low-cost. Great care was required to provide environmental and dietary worth to the plant. Soon, after embracing ex-vitro for jatropha plant, the 2 months plantlets were prepared to be planted in the field. Rooting was accomplished, in around three weeks. The institutes engaged in ex-vitro jatropha techniques of plant proliferation took utmost care in supporting the plants by creating natural conditions. For example, jatropha grows in well drained soil and is dry spell resistant. The ex-vitro technique also, increased the level of seedlings, which were free from pest and disease. This method of ex-vitro of jatropha showed simple and low-cost and the seedlings were close to their parent, hence, avoiding complications.
There are particular elements that can affect the ex-vitro growth in jatropha curcas plants. They are like sunlight, humidity, nature of soil and other weather conditions. Hence, care has actually to be taken to change these aspects to match ex-vitro.
